This episode features a variety of comedic sketches, including "A Message From David Rockefeller," "Ed MacMahon School of Laughing," and "What It Is All About." Other highlights include "The Rocket Report," "Paulie Herman," and "Our Front Door." Additionally, viewers are treated to "Pepe Gonzales," "Valley Girls," and "Sam the Snake." The lineup also features "The Toni Tenille Show," the quirky "Fish Heads," "Blame For Divorce," and a humorous take on aging with "Old Lady." Ellen Burstyn and Aretha Franklin bring their unique flair to the performances throughout the show.
